Deathly Definition & Meaning
deathly
- adverb
- to a degree resembling death; "he was deathly pale"
- adjective
- having the physical appearance of death; "a deathly pallor"
- causing or capable of causing death; "a fatal accident"; "a deadly enemy"; "mortal combat"; "a mortal illness"
